1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a preposition?
Back
A preposition is a word that shows the relationship between a noun (or pronoun) and other words in a sentence. Examples include 'in', 'on', 'under', and 'over'.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Identify the preposition in the sentence: 'The kitten was hiding under the table.'
Back
under
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is figurative language?
Back
Figurative language uses words or expressions with a meaning that is different from the literal interpretation. It includes similes, metaphors, personification, and idioms.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is personification?
Back
Personification is a type of figurative language where human qualities are given to animals, objects, or ideas. For example, 'The wind howled through the trees'.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a conjunction?
Back
A conjunction is a word that connects clauses or sentences or coordinates words in the same clause. Examples include 'and', 'but', and 'or'.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Identify the conjunction in the sentence: 'I want to watch a movie, but I also want to read my book.'
Back
but
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are verb tenses?
Back
Verb tenses indicate the time of action or state of being. The main tenses are past, present, and future.
